In surgical robots and infusion pumps, our Coreless Brushless Motors provide the non-cogging, smooth motion necessary for life-critical precision. The high power-to-weight ratio allows for lighter, more portable medical devices.
High-torque N20 geared motors are the heart of next-gen smart locks and surveillance gimbal systems. They provide the necessary locking force while maintaining a compact footprint for sleek architectural designs.
From Lawn Mower Motors with Hall sensors to automated seeding drones, our high-torque BLDC solutions provide the ruggedness required for outdoor, high-vibration environments.
The GM25-370CA is specifically designed for TV broadcast satellite antennas, providing the micro-step precision needed for signal tracking without signal interference.
Reliable TT Motors and micro DC gears power the educational robotics and hobbyist markets, balancing cost with ISO9001 certified durability.
Miniature stepper motors (15BY series) ensure camera lenses achieve perfect focus and zoom with zero mechanical lag, supporting the 4K and 8K imaging revolution.

Coreless motors eliminate the iron core in the rotor, resulting in much lower inertia, no cogging torque, and extremely fast acceleration. This makes them ideal for precision medical tools and high-speed robotic joints.
